INTENT:
To limit the probability of openings in environmental separators,
which could lead to:
- the ingress of precipitation,
- the ingress of insects or vermin,
- excessive heat transfer,
- condensation,
- the accumulation of moisture or the ingress of water backed
up by ice dams,
- drafts, or
- the ingress of pollutants from adjacent attic or roof spaces.
This is to limit the probability of:
- compromised thermal performance of components intended to provide
resistance to heat transfer, which could lead to an inadequate control of
the temperature of interior spaces or relative humidity,
- the generation of pollutants from biological growth or from
materials that become unstable on wetting,
- deterioration, which could lead to compromised integrity of
ceilings acting as environmental separators, or
- water accumulation in interior spaces.
This is to limit the probability of:
- negative effects on the air quality of indoor spaces,
- the inadequate thermal comfort of persons, and
- contact with moisture.
This is to limit the probability of harm to persons.
